Abstract

The invention relates to a bridge type drying chamber. The bridge type drying chamber comprises a chamber body, and the chamber body is fixed and supported by furnace body brackets; the bridge type drying chamber is characterized in that a workpiece inlet / outlet is formed in the front end of the chamber body, and a rotary region is arranged at the rear end of the chamber body; the workpiece inlet / outlet of the chamber body includes an upper space and a lower space, the upper space is communicated with the chamber body and is as high as the chamber body, the lower space is located below the upper space, the lower space is communicated with the upper space, and the lower space is located between the furnace body brackets; a hot air circulation system, an air supply system and an air return system are arranged between the workpiece inlet / outlet and rotary region. The hot air circulation system comprises a hot air fan and a hot air pipe, the hot air fan is arranged at the outer side of the bottom of the chamber body, and the air outlet of the hot air fan is connected with the air supply system at the bottom of the chamber body through the hot air pipe. The air supply system is an air supply hole formed in the bottom of the chamber body. The bridge type drying chamber enables the equipment arrangement space and energy consumption to be effectively saved.

Description

technical field [0001] The invention relates to a bridge-type drying chamber, which belongs to the technical field of coating equipment. Background technique [0002] At present, the surface drying of domestic construction machinery products generally uses professional equipment such as straight-through drying chambers and straight-through bridge drying chambers for paint drying. [0003] One of the design principles of the drying chamber is to satisfy the baking temperature, the smaller the overall equipment volume, the lower the energy consumption. The problems existing in the drying room in the prior art are mainly that the arrangement space is relatively large, and the energy consumption is relatively high. Contents of the invention [0004] The object of the present invention is to overcome the deficiencies in the prior art and provide a bridge-type drying chamber, which effectively saves equipment layout space and energy consumption.
